The Believers (Al-Mu' minoon)
In the name of God, The Most Gracious, The Dispenser of Grace
۞ Blissful are the believers 1 Who are humble in their service, 2 And those who turn away from Al-Laghw (dirty, false, evil vain talk, falsehood, and all that Allah has forbidden). 3 pay their religious tax 4 and guard their private parts 5 except with their wives and what their right hand possess, and then they are not blamed. 6 As for those who seek beyond that, they are transgressors" 7 those who are true to their trust, 8 And those who keep a guard on their prayers; 9 Those are the inheritors 10 Who will inherit paradise. There they will abide. 11 We created the human from an essence of clay: 12 Thereafter We made him (the offspring of Adam) as a Nutfah (mixed drops of the male and female sexual discharge) (and lodged it) in a safe lodging (womb of the woman). 13 Then We made the seed a clot, then We made the clot a lump of flesh, then We made (in) the lump of flesh bones, then We clothed the bones with flesh, then We caused it to grow into another creation, so blessed be Allah, the best of the creators. 14 Then indeed, after that you are to die. 15 Then you will all be raised on the Day of Resurrection. 16 And We have created above you seven paths, and We are never unmindful of creation. 17 We have sent a measure of water from the sky to stay on earth and We have the power to take it away. 18 So with it We produced gardens of date-palms and grapes for you, in which is abundant fruit for you and you eat therefrom. 19 also a tree growing on Mount Sinai which produces oil and a condiment for those who eat it. 20 In the cattle, too, is a lesson for you. We let you drink of that which is in their bellies, and there are many benefits in them for you, and you eat of them, 21 and by them - as by the ships [over the sea] - you are borne [overland]. 22
